Associations to the word «Storefront»

Wiktionary

STOREFRONT, noun. The side of a store (or other shop) which faces the street; usually contains display windows

Dictionary definition

STOREFRONT, noun. The front side of a store facing the street; usually contains display windows.

Wise words

One merit of poetry few persons will deny: it says more and in fewer words than prose.
Voltaire